Output 4a04b45954566bb39d0a9b5189577df3b2a69164f1d7c43f9440dac3a6132141:2

value
25417492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 558e77b7bdf1df42af88bdebf5044e1e3869ac90 OP_EQUAL
address
MFhYLZWzJVj9sEHx9jwcoHPYBmoP6PagAJ
transaction
4a04b45954566bb39d0a9b5189577df3b2a69164f1d7c43f9440dac3a6132141
spent
true